Please only apply for this greyhound if you have:
Taken Scout's following needs into consideration if you are wishing to adopt this beautiful boy.
• Scout needs 30mins+ walking a day (he loves a long morning walk with a shorter walk in the evenings as well).
• A single level home – but some entrance steps are fine.
• Grassed yard with space to Zoomie and continue to build strength in his back legs.
• Children must be 8 years or older.
• He is fine without another dog as he is happy being by himself, though will whimper a little when you leave, but only because he loves you!
• He has spent school hours alone during the day without problem.
• Likes to sleep in your bedroom at night!
• He will need constant access to outside. His toileting will need to be carefully managed – e.g. needs to be taken outside when you return home from a day out, and first thing in the morning.
Scout is an adorable 11-month-old Greyhound Pup, who requires a little more attention than most greyhounds, but he is so well worth the effort. Scout has some neurological issues with his hind legs – particularly the right leg. At the beginning of this year, he was found collapsed in the field and completely unable to stand/walk and so was taken into the care of R2R. Subsequent specialised vet tests have shown that he likely ingested a toxin which caused this collapse.
But Scout is so much better now! He is a true boy scout and with lots of loving care he has soldiered on and improved beyond our expectations. He gets stronger every week, and can now walk, navigate stairs, jump, run, Zoomie, and leap super high!
Scout is affectionate and loves pats and playing with any toy (or piece of clothing!) he finds. Scout is VERY intelligent! He walks very well on a lead, is not perturbed by other dogs however can sometimes become a little frightened by an unfamiliar letter box! He has spent time with other dogs and whilst he is interested initially, he settles quickly and interacts with them very well. So, he would be fine living with another dog.
Being a pup, Scout is more energetic than older greyhounds. We have found he is very calm after longer walks (he can now manage over 35mins even with hills) but is also calm and happy after a 15-minute stroll. Scout will need a grassed yard as he just loves to Zoomie at least 2-3 times per day, and interestingly this helps to encourage a wee!
Scout is a very friendly dog both around adults and children, our kids are 7, 9 and 11 and he has been awesome with them. We have noticed he treats them like siblings – which can be a bit of an issue when he gets revved up. So, ideally kids in his forever home need to be 8+ years.
Scout is super easy to travel with by car, covering 3-hour trips to the country without a problem. He does struggle to get into the car and still needs assistance to lift him in. Just recently he has managed to jump safely out of a high car by himself.
When this “barely able to walk boy” came into R2R, the neurological issues with his rear end meant he was completely incontinent for both urine and faeces. Thankfully, the latter with treatment sorted itself out and we have learned to manage his urinary issues, so most of the time they are barely an issue. Scout can hold on well, but sometimes forgets he needs to go wee and leaves it too late to get outside. We will happily teach you how we have learned to manage him!
Scout is truly a beautiful boy and would make an amazing addition to a loving family, couple or single person who has a little more patience to learn his unique needs. We just adore him!
